Ramming mass is commonly used in metallurgy, building materials, non-ferrous metal smelting, chemical, machinery and other manufacturing industries. Ramming mass is widely used in non-core intermediate frequency furnace and core induction furnace. As an intermediate frequency furnace ramming material, refractory ramming is applied to melt gray cast iron, nodular cast iron, malleable cast iron, vermicular cast iron, and cast alloy steel; to melt carbon steel, alloy steel, high manganese steel, tool steel, heat resistant steel, stainless steel, molten aluminum and its alloys; to melt red copper, brass, white brass, bronze and its alloys, etc. Induction furnaces are used for melting cast iron, mild steel and various alloy steels in foundries and making of steel in mini steel plants using sponge iron The refined high silicon, low iron quartz sand and quartz powder are selected and the fused quartz sand is added as the refractory material., with no slag, no crack, damp proof, convenience of repair, and the corrosion resistance, thus greatly improving the furnace service life span and the economic benefit.. Silica ramming mass can safely be used up to an operating temperature of 1600 deg C. Since it expands very little, it is superior to both alumina and magnesia refractories to resist thermal shocks Acid ramming material is the premixed ramming mass of the lining material. The acid ramming mass is used to smelt a series of metal materials such as ordinary steel and carbon steel. The lining practice best suited to a particular furnace depends upon the capacity and design of the furnace, operation practice adopted during making of a heat, and furnace output.

Silica is mainly used as a carrier of agricultural chemicals. Finely crushed silica powder is coated with agricultural chemicals and sold on the market for agricultural use. Silica itself has no effects; it merely serves as a carrier, and so can be dispersed without affecting the farmland, which makes it advantageous as a core material. Silica ramming mass is also known as acidic ramming mass or silica mix, is used in careless induction furnaces, for melting of scrap. Quality of acidic ramming mass is directly related to the heating performance of the furnaces. Better quality of lining results in the smooth working of furnaces, optimum output and better metallurgical control. We supply all types of ramming mass as per customer's requirement. The main raw material of siliceous ramming material is silica, which is the general name of ganglite, quartzite and quartz sandstone.Acid refractory brick mainly used in metallurgical industry.Pure silica can be used as quartz glass or refined as monocrystalline silicon.In the chemical industry, it is used for the preparation of silicon compounds and silicates, and also as the filling material of sulfuric acid tower.Building materials industry for glass, ceramics, Portland cement and so on.
